Joint inflammation in rheumatoid arthritis has been assessed, and the most useful guides to disease activity were determined by analysis of synovial fluid and blood together with the history of joint disability. The patient's own evaluation of the amount of pain suffered was the most useful clinical assessment. Differential cell count and glucose estimations were the most helpful guides in the synovial fluid, while C-reactive protein in the serum most accurately reflected disease activity. The effects of systemic steroids on these indices were studied, and the differences between seronegative and seropositive patients noted.

The influence of diclofenac, given by continuous i.v. infusion starting preoperatively, on postoperative pain and inflammation was assessed in a double-blind, randomized, placebo-controlled study in 40 patients scheduled for major orthopedic surgery. Starting 30 min before induction the patients received either diclofenac (0.35 mg.kg-1 bolus followed by a constant-rate infusion of 90 micrograms.min-1) or placebo for 24 h. The pain intensity (VAS) and the amount of rescue narcotic (piritramide on demand) were significantly lower in the diclofenac group from 4 and 6 h postsurgery, respectively, till end of infusion. Acute phase proteins used as inflammation markers (C-reactive protein, alpha 1-chymotrypsin, alpha 1-acid glycoprotein, haptoglobin and coeruloplasmin) showed similar variations in both groups for 24 h. The diclofenac treatment had no influence on hematological and coagulation profiles, nor on muscle and liver enzymes in comparison with placebo. Both patients and observer rated the diclofenac treatment as significantly superior to the placebo treatment.

We measured the pain tenderness threshold at 16 fibrositic tender points in 44 consecutive patients with rheumatoid arthritis (RA) attending the outpatient rheumatology clinic of a university hospital. Pressure threshold measurements were transformed to z units to equalize the weights of the values at different anatomic sites and were then summed. This pain tenderness score correlated with the joint score index (p less than 0.02, r = -0.363), signifying a low pain threshold in the patients with a high joint score index. In contrast to this, the pain tenderness score was not explained by either personality factors or the generalized disease activity measuring variables (erythrocyte sedimentation rate, C-reactive protein). Our results show that the fibrositic point tenderness is real in RA, and that the tenderness is augmented near the active joints. The pain tenderness score of patients with RA is not affected by the subject's personality but may relate to sensitization of the pain fibers in arthritic joints.

We have compared metabolic and respiratory changes after laparoscopic cholecystectomy (n = 15) with those after open cholecystectomy (n = 15). The durations of postoperative i.v. therapy, fasting and hospital stay were significantly shorter in the laparoscopy group. During the first and second days after operation, analgesic consumption but not pain scores (visual analogue scale) were significantly smaller after laparoscopy, while vital capacity, forced expiratory volume in 1 s, and PaO2 were significantly greater. The metabolic and acute phase responses (glucose, leucocytosis, C-reactive protein) were less after laparoscopy compared with laparotomy. Although plasma cortisol and catecholamine concentrations were not significantly different between the two groups, after surgery interleukin-6 concentrations were less in the laparoscopy group.

This study examined respiratory function and metabolic and subjective responses in patients undergoing laparoscopic (n = 10) and open (n = 11) cholecystectomy for chronic cholecystitis and biliary colic. Patient groups were matched for age, sex, weight and height. The duration of operation was similar in both groups. Respiratory function tests (vital capacity, forced expiratory volume in 1 s, peak flow and arterial blood gases), urinary cortisol, vanillylmandelic acid, metanephrines and nitrogen loss, serum complement component C3 and C-reactive protein (CRP), full blood count, erythrocyte sedimentation rate (ESR) and subjective responses as assessed on a pain analogue scale and by analgesic usage were determined for up to 48 h after surgery. Deterioration in perioperative respiratory function was significantly less for laparoscopic surgery. Arterial blood gas determinations indicated a greater perioperative decrease in arterial pH, with carbon dioxide retention in patients undergoing open cholecystectomy (P < 0.02), reflecting poorer respiratory performance. Hormonal profile changes demonstrated an increase in urinary vanillylmandelic acid in the laparoscopic cholecystectomy group (P < 0.04); no differences were detected in urinary cortisol, metanephrine or nitrogen excretion. Acute-phase responses were greatest in patients undergoing open cholecystectomy as determined by ESR and CRP level (P < 0.02 and P < 0.003, respectively). Pain and analgesic usage were significantly decreased in the laparoscopic cholecystectomy group (P < 0.0009) and P < 0.0001), which led to a decreased hospital stay after operation in these patients (P < 0.0001). These data indicate improved respiratory and subjective responses and diminished acute-phase responses associated with laparoscopic surgery. Catabolic hormone release may, however, be increased.

The ability of 99mtechnetium labelled nonspecific, polyclonal human immunoglobulin G (99mTc-IgG) scintigraphy to depict and quantify synovial inflammation was studied in 30 patients with rheumatoid arthritis (RA). All patients were injected with 350 MBq 99mTc-IgG and imaging was performed 4 h later. This resulted in excellent images of inflamed synovium. Scores for 99mTc-IgG joint scintigraphy correlated highly with scores for joint swelling and C-reactive protein levels, weakly with pain scores and not with radiographic scores of joint destruction. These results suggest that 99mTc-IgG joint scintigraphy may provide an objective test to detect synovitis and measure the activity of the disease.

The most suitable measures to assess the disease activity of rheumatoid arthritis patients treated with slow-acting anti-rheumatic drugs were considered in a prospective study. This was organised across Europe in 12 specialised centres and 282 patients were studied. The patients were all considered to be in need of therapy with a slow-acting anti-rheumatic drug and were studied at the initiation of therapy, and after 3 and 6 months of treatment. There were 215 patients who remained on treatment for 6 months. The most useful measures to assess disease activity were: the number of swollen joints, the number of tender joints, pain, the patients' assessment of response, and ESR. These should form a minimum data set when assessing the activity of rheumatoid arthritis. Some measures such as grip strength, hemoglobin, and the C-reactive protein level showed too much variation between centres and will require considerable standardisation before they can be used across Europe. There were problems in collecting functional data and further work is needed to develop a functional questionnaire available in all European languages with culturally suitable questions.

Two cases of painless subacute thyroiditis were presented in whom fever, fatigue and arthralgia except for thyroidal pain and swelling were complained. Until a intense uptake of the thyroid was found on radiogallium scintigraphy, the examinations of the thyroid had not been done. Laboratory data showed increased erythrocyte sedimentation rate, C-reactive protein and serum alkaline phosphatase, and mild leukocytosis. Skeletal, hepatic and biliary diseases were denied. In patients who have fever, increased erythrocyte sedimentation rate and serum alkaline phosphatase elevation without apparent sources, thyroid function should be evaluated because subacute thyroiditis can be associated with elevation of the serum alkaline phosphatase.

In an open study, a new treatment modality was evaluated in 22 patients with active ankylosing spondylitis and compared with oral treatment. Patients were given a 10-week course of rifamycin SV infiltrations to all large peripheral joints, whether or not affected, and were followed for up to 12 months after the end of treatment. Clinical improvements observed at the end of the 10-week treatment cycle persisted for 12 months: morning stiffness (P less than 0.02); subjective pain (P less than 0.0001); Schober's test (P less than 0.006); hand-ground distance (P less than 0.001); erythrocyte sedimentation rate (P less than 0.001); and C-reactive protein (P less than 0.04). The number of painful joints became significantly lower at 6 (P less than 0.01) and 12 months (P less than 0.02) of the follow-up period. Oral administration of rifampin at three times the intra-articular dosage was devoid of any therapeutic activity. It is not known how treatment of peripheral joints influenced the inflammatory process at the level of the axial skeleton. These results must be considered preliminary due to the small number of patients and the short follow-up period, and because it was an open study.

Twenty patients undergoing colonic resection were randomized to either conventional postoperative pain treatment with morphine chloride and acetaminophen (group 1, n = 9) or methylprednisolone sodium succinate 90 minutes before surgery plus intraoperative neural blockade, with a postoperative analgesic regimen with combined bupivacaine hydrochloride-morphine and indomethacin sodium for systemic effect (group 2, n = 11). Assessments of pain, pulmonary function, convalescence, and various injury factors were done several times until 8 days after surgery. Postoperative pain and hyperthermic response were eliminated in group 2. Conventional reduction in pulmonary function measures was improved in group 2, and fatigue and mobility were less pronounced. Prostaglandin E2, interleukin 6, and C-reactive protein levels increased in both groups, but significantly less in group 2. These results suggest that a combined neural and humoral blockade may more effectively inhibit the global stress response to elective surgery than previously observed with neural blockade with or without indomethacin.
